2013-S7040 (ACTIVE) - Sponsor Memo
BILL NUMBER:S7040 TITLE OF BILL: An act to amend the environmental conservation law, in relation to prohibiting the purchase and sale of ivory articles and to increase the penalties for the illegal commercialization of fish, shellfish, crustacea and wildlife, including ivory articles PURPOSE OR GENERAL IDEA OF BILL: To close New York State as a market for ivory sales to help prevent elephant extinction and to reduce funding sources for terrorists. SUMMARY OF PROVISIONS: This bill would: * prohibit the sale, offer for sale, purchase, trade, barter, or distribution other than to a legal beneficiary of an ivory article; * authorize the Department of Environmental Conservation (DEC) to adopt rules and regulations, following a public hearing, to include any other animal parts containing ivory in the prohibitions provided that such parts are from animals classified as endangered or threatened; * define "ivory article" to include worked or raw ivory from any

S T A T E O F N E W Y O R K ________________________________________________________________________ 7040 I N S E N A T E April 21, 2014 ___________ Introduced by Sen. AVELLA -- read twice and ordered printed, and when printed to be committed to the Committee on Environmental Conservation AN ACT to amend the environmental conservation law, in relation to prohibiting the purchase and sale of ivory articles and to increase the penalties for the illegal commercialization of fish, shellfish, crustacea and wildlife, including ivory articles TH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M- B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S: Section 1. The environmental conservation law is amended by adding a new section 11-0535-a to read as follows: S 11-0535-A. ILLEGAL IVORY ARTICLES. 1. NOTWITHSTANDING THE PROVISIONS OF SUBDIVISION TWO OF SECTION 11-0535 OF THIS TITLE, WHICH AUTHORIZES THE DEPARTMENT TO ISSUE CERTAIN LICENSES OR PERMITS, NO PERSON SHALL SELL, OFFER FOR SALE, PURCHASE, TRADE, BARTER, OR DISTRIBUTE OTHER THAN TO A LEGAL BENEFICIARY, AN IVORY ARTICLE. A. "IVORY ARTICLE" MEANS ANY ITEM CONTAINING: (I) WORKED OR RAW IVORY FROM ANY SPECIES OF ELEPHANT OR MAMMOTH; OR (II) ANY ANIMAL PART CONTAINING IVORY INCLUDED BY THE COMMISSIONER PURSUANT TO SUBDIVISION TWO OF THIS SECTION. B. "WORKED IVORY" MEANS ANY ELEPHANT OR MAMMOTH TUSK, AND ANY PIECE THEREOF, WHICH IS NOT RAW IVORY. C. "RAW IVORY" MEANS ANY ELEPHANT OR MAMMOTH TUSK, AND ANY PIECE THEREOF, THE SURFACE OF WHICH, POLISHED, OR UNPOLISHED, IS UNALTERED OR MINIMALLY CARVED. 2. THE COMMISSIONER MAY ADOPT RULES AND REGULATIONS EXPANDING THE DEFINITION OF "IVORY ARTICLE" TO INCLUDE ANY OTHER ANIMAL PARTS CONTAIN- ING IVORY PROVIDED THAT SUCH PARTS ARE FROM ANIMALS CLASSIFIED AS ENDAN- GERED OR THREATENED AND PROVIDED THAT THE COMMISSIONER HAS HELD AT LEAST ONE PUBLIC HEARING PRIOR TO THE ADOPTION OF SUCH RULES AND REGULATIONS.
